gilgamesh wrote: 12 Apr 2018, 14:34 Well...if it's a credible, but not too dangerous you're looking for there's lots of choices.

Chris Arreola, Eric Molina, Bermane Stiverne or Gerald Washington (though the latter two might be a bit tougher than you'd want for your first fight back)
Is Arreola still active?

The other guys probably would want more money than Warren is willing to part with.

And lets face it. In the UK, Fury's return is a major event. The opponent is just being brought in because the rules state that there has to be one.

First time out, whoever they put in there with Fury will be fine with the public. They'll gobble it up.

It didn't hurt Mike Tyson when he opted to take on a big no-hoper like McNeeley.

Fans didn't care about a competitive fight. They just wanted to see Tyson. Plenty of curiosity.

It will be the same with Fury. They can put him in with Kevin Johnson or Julius Long. Fans will still turn out in droves.
